06 Jul 2018 20:31 #194065 by Lambert
Replied by Lambert on topic Discreet but capable
If you have genuine Suzuki rotors be prepared for the green stuff pads to beat the daylights out of the disks. The ebc rotors seems to be possibly a better match but they only have a couple of thousand miles on them so experience is limited.
